psychology-today-logo.pngHow Much Does an ADHD Private Diagnosis in the UK Cost?

BBC Panorama's investigation into ADHD services in the UK brought the issue to the fore once again. The investigation shows that many people pay for private assessments and prescriptions because of the lengthy NHS waiting lists.

The private route may provide the fastest and most thorough diagnosis by a specialist psychiatrist. Prices range between PS500 and PS1,200.

Costs

When it concerns ADHD, the costs associated with diagnosis and treatment can be substantial. There are, however, ways to cut down on the costs. You can also get a private evaluation from a reputable provider. This will result in an earlier and more precise diagnosis rather than waiting on a NHS list. It also allows you to choose a clinic that fits your budget and needs.

The cost of an adult ADHD assessment varies from clinic to clinic. It can range from PS600 to PS1050. It can be conducted face-to-face or through video calls. An adult ADHD assessment will include an evaluation of the person's symptoms and a discussion with a psychologist or psychiatrist, and a medical exam. It can take around 90 minutes to complete the test.

Certain insurance companies may not cover ADHD tests. Aviva for instance claims that it doesn't cover the treatment of psychiatric disorders since they are chronic. However the fact that many parents prefer to seek a private examination because it's more likely lead to an assessment. Additionally, it's less costly than waiting for an NHS appointment.

Waiting at various times

In response to two petitions MPs held two petitions, MPs held a Westminster Hall Debate on the long waiting times for ADHD treatment and assessment. The debate has highlighted the issues of children and adults with undiagnosed ADHD. The debate also covered the negative effects of delays on mental health, education and the education system. The petitioners claim that there is a national crisis in the provision of ADHD assessments and treatment. They demand that NHS services meet high standards by logging waiting times.

The government has stood up for NHS services by saying that Nice guidelines are clear, and that integrated care boards (ICBCs) and NHS Trusts commission ADHD services. However some critics refer to internal reports that suggest the NHS is unable to meet demand for ADHD services. This may be because of an uneasy relationship between the desire to speed up the time it takes for patients and the costs of increased service delivery.

There are many methods to avoid the lengthy waiting times associated with the NHS diagnosis of ADHD and private healthcare. private diagnosis for adhd psychiatrists are generally adept at diagnosing adult adhd diagnosis private uk and will often test for co-morbidities, like depression and anxiety which are common among people with ADHD. They may also prescribe treatment. The costs for an assessment of ADHD vary depending the location you reside in and the type of diagnosis you require, but could range from PS500 to PS1,200 in London.

Many people are compelled by the long waits for ADHD treatment on the NHS to seek out private treatment. For instance, Will Belshah, 29, had to wait 18 months for a prescription for the medication Xaggatin at his GP practice. He feels 'in limbo,' as he struggles for the help he requires.

NHS Right to Choose is another option that permits patients to choose their preferred healthcare provider. Adults in England can choose an independent clinic that has been approved by the NHS to avoid waiting lists. It is important to note that each private healthcare facility will have their own set of rules regarding if a referral letter from a doctor is required to conduct an evaluation. Some will ask for an GP referral, whereas others will not.

Medication

getting diagnosed with adhd a private diagnosis of ADHD can be a challenge particularly when you are looking for medication. Many GPs will refuse to sign an agreement for shared care with you if you receive a diagnosis privately without also being fully titrated to a final dose of medication. Before you get your ADHD assessment, make sure you record the areas you are struggling with and the reasons why. This will allow you to be more specific in your responses. It is also important to note down any family history of mental illness that you are aware of. The psychiatrist or psychiatric nurse will ask you various questions about your symptoms and behaviours. They will also ask you about your family and work routine, and how to diagnose adhd in adults your health issues affect them. They will also ask about any mental health issues you may have.

Private assessments typically last between 45-90 minutes and are conducted either in person or by video conference. The psychiatrist will ask you to fill in ADHD questionnaires and conduct an organized interview. You will also discuss your current problems with him. The psychiatrist will discuss your history of mental health and any issues you may be experiencing. It is crucial to be honest when answering these questions, as they will be using them to diagnose you.

The Psychiatrist will determine if you suffer from ADHD or not, and then prescribe medications. Typically, they prescribe Atomoxetine first, Methylphenidate second and then Dexamfetamine at the end. If the first prescription doesn't work for you, then your doctor will modify the prescription.

It is crucial to remember that only a specialist nurse or psychiatrist can prescribe medication in the UK for ADHD. Other healthcare professionals, like Psychologists, may conduct assessments, but they aren't qualified to prescribe medications for ADHD. A Psychiatrist, or a specialist nurse is required to diagnose ADHD.
